RT Journal Article T1 A New Automatic System for Angular Measurement and Calibration in Radiometric Instruments A1 Andújar Márquez, José Manuel A1 Martínez Bohórquez, Miguel Ángel A1 Aguilar Nieto, Francisco José A1 Medina García, Jonathan AB This paper puts forward the design, construction and testing of a new automatic system for angular-response measurement and calibration in radiometric instruments. Its main characteristics include precision, speed, resolution, noise immunity, easy programming and operation. The developed system calculates the cosine error of the radiometer under test by means of a virtual instrument, from the measures it takes and through a mathematical procedure, thus allowing correcting the radiometer with the aim of preventing cosine error in its measurements.
